Things to do in Kota Bharu
Kota Bharu is the capital of Kelantan, Malaysia's most traditional Malay state, and the gateway to the Perhentian Islands. It suits culture-curious travellers and island-goers in transit. Come March to October — the monsoon shuts the islands from November to February.
- Siti Khadijah Central Market — a photogenic, women-run produce market
- Handicraft villages for batik, songket weaving and silverwork
- Istana Jahar museum of Kelantanese royal ceremonies
- Transfer to Kuala Besut jetty for the Perhentian Islands (about an hour by road)
